100 Wins!

 

Creating a piece of history on a short week, the Polar Bears rolled up the Greencastle Blue Devils last night to notch Head Coach Rick Mauck's 100th coaching victory.  The Bears scored early and often in what can only be described as nearly perfect efficiency in the first half.  On the 3rd play from scrimmage, Colby Betz threw to Drew Romagnoli who broke a tackle on the Northern sideline and raced 70 yards for the touchdown.  It was Drew's first of four touchdowns on the night.  On the Bear's second possession, Colby hit Drew again for a 49 yard touchdown pass.  Greencastle came back when Tyreek Thrush scored on a 20 yard run.  The kick failed and Northern led 14-6.  Brent Brockman hit a 22 yard field goal to close out scoring in the first quarter and the Bears led 17-6.  The 2nd quarter held more scoring for Drew Romagnoli who is making a loud statement this year.  After Colby Betz scored from a yard out on a quarterback sneak, the Blue Devils answered on another Thrush touchdown but then it was Drew's turn.  He first scored on a 39 yard pass from Colby but then as the clock was winding down in the half and Greencastle was again moving the ball, Keith Kunkle tipped a pass from Blake Border which Drew gathered in and raced 39 yards for the interception return for a touchdown.  At the half, the bears led 38-14.  Drew had already caught 3 passes for 155 yards and three touchdowns as well as a touchdown on an interception.

 

There was no scoring in the 3rd quarter and the 4th saw the Bears and the Blue Devils trade a pair of touchdowns.  The most remarkable came as Greencastle tried an onsides kick to attempt to pull themselves back into the game somehow.  The kick was fielded cleanly by Keith Kunkle who raced 47 yards untouched for the touchdown.  Kunkle was definitely the special teams player of the night,  Earlier, he took out a blocker and the ball carrier after sacrificing himself on a kickoff.  It was a thing of Beauty.  Special Team kudos also go out to Bears Kicker, Brent Brockman who, himself, was perfect on the night with 7 of 7 extra points and 1 of 1 field goals from 22 yards.

 

The game was a great way for the Bears to get healthy after the heartbreaking, last-minute loss to Mechanicsburg last week.  They begin conference play with a big win and look forward to going 2-0 in the conference next week after hosting the Greyhounds of Shippensburg at Bostic.  Kickoff is at 7:30
